Every three years the Pension Fund undergoes a ‘re-valuation’ of its assets and liabilities.
The valuation is a health check to see if the Fund’s assets are sufficient to meet its liabilities. It is carried out by the actuary to the Fund, Barnett Waddingham LLP.
The key purpose of the valuation is to set employer contribution rates for the forthcoming valuation period - 1 April 2026 to 31 March 2029.
The full 2025 valuation report is published in our Reports section. This section also includes an archive of previous valuation reports dating back to 2004.
